APPOINTMENT OF PRINCIPAL AUDITOR
IN THE GIBRALTAR AUDIT OFFICE
The Specified Appointments Commission invites applications to the post of Principal Auditor in the Gibraltar Audit Office.
The Gibraltar Audit Office, headed by the Principal Auditor, is the independent public audit body responsible for auditing the public accounts of Gibraltar, its statutory corporations, authorities and agencies.
Applicants must be British Citizens and are, or will be on taking up the appointment, resident in Gibraltar.
Applicants should have attained a full professional accountancy qualification under any of the UK chartered accountancy bodies and have significant post qualification external audit experience, preferably in a public audit service organisation. This should include experience operating at a senior level (Director/Partner or Executive Director).
The appointment will be for an initial (fixed term) period of three years.
